Overview: Bandung Institute of Technology
The Bandung Institute of Technology (Institut Teknologi Bandung, ITB) is a premier public research university founded in 1920 in Bandung, West Java, Indonesia. As the country’s oldest higher education institution for science and technology, ITB stands at the forefront of Indonesia’s academic landscape. Today, it boasts over 23,000 students and nearly 2,000 academic staff, spread across 12 faculties on its main Ganesha campus and satellite campuses. ITB is renowned for its comprehensive approach, emphasizing both research excellence and high-quality teaching in a vibrant urban setting.
ITB is especially distinguished for its programs in engineering, natural sciences, and architecture, consistently ranked among the top in Asia—for example, its engineering and technology programs are frequently placed within the top 300 QS World University Rankings. The university is known for its rigorous interdisciplinary curriculum and problem-based learning philosophy, fostering innovation and critical thinking. ITB has established strong research ties both regionally and globally, partnering with leading institutions for joint degrees, research consortia, and academic exchange. Notable achievements include pioneering sustainable technology solutions, contributions to national infrastructure, and a robust record of scholarly publications in high-impact journals.
Student life at ITB is vibrant and diverse, supported by more than 120 student organizations encompassing interests in technology, arts, sports, culture, and entrepreneurship. The university regularly hosts national and international cultural festivals, seminars, and competitions. A range of on-campus student services—such as counseling, career development, and scholarship support—underpins an inclusive campus culture. ITB prioritizes a multicultural environment, with outreach programs and increasing numbers of international students and faculty. Residential facilities, extensive sports complexes, and artist studios further enrich the student experience, encouraging holistic development.
